This is not a last-time-buy window — production has ended. ## Quad LVDS receiver — 400 Mbps, 50 mV hysteresis The SN65LVDS3486AD is a quad-channel LVDS receiver from TI's 65LVDS family, in a 16-SOIC package. It converts four differential LVDS signal pairs into single-ended CMOS outputs, rated for a 400 Mbps per-channel data rate. The 50 mV of receiver hysteresis provides noise rejection on the differential inputs — useful when the cable run picks up common-mode noise in an industrial or telecom backplane environment. The industrial temperature rating means the receiver's input thresholds and output timing stay within spec across the full span — no derating needed for a 70°C cabinet interior.","metaTitle":"SN65LVDS3486AD LVDS Receiver, 400 Mbps, 16-SOIC, Obsolete","metaDescription":"TI SN65LVDS3486AD quad LVDS receiver, 400 Mbps data rate, 50 mV hysteresis, 3V-3.6V supply, -40°C to 85°C.","metaKeywords":null},"attributes":{"series":null,"packageCase":null,"mountingType":null,"rohsStatus":null,"productStatus":"Obsolete","categoryPath":["Interface & Transceivers"],"specifications":{"Mfr":"Texas Instruments","Type":"Receiver","Duplex":"-","Series":"65LVDS","Package":"Tube","Protocol":"LVDS","Data Rate":"400Mbps","Mounting Type":"Surface Mount","Package / Case":"16-SOIC (0.154\\\", 3.90mm Width)","Product Status":"Obsolete","lifecycle_stage":"eol_hot","Voltage - Supply":"3V ~ 3.6V","Base Product Number":"SN65L","Receiver Hysteresis":"50 mV","Operating Temperature":"-40°C~85°C","Supplier Device Package":"16-SOIC","Number of Drivers/Receivers":"0/4"}},"commercial":{"minOrderQty":null,"leadTime":null,"referencePrice":"$4.9100","priceTiers":null},"links":{"datasheetUrl":"https://cdn.icboms.com/752df2947af162b73af624a0d70223bf.pdf","sourceUrl":null,"alternativesUrl":"https://icboms.com/api/mcp/products/SN65LVDS3486AD/alternatives.json"},"ai":{"faq":[{"question":"What is the replacement for the SN65LVDS3486AD?","answer":"TI's official successor for this part is not listed in the available records.
